Accident Summary Nr: 200021392 - Employee killed when run over by backing flatbed truck

Abstract: Employee #1 and a coworker were part of a crew hired by the New Jersey Turnpike Authority to repair sections of the roadway. Employee #1 was directing the coworker as he was backing a GMC flatbed attenuator truck through a narrow space between some safety lights and a sprayer machine used to apply a protective membrane over bridges. Employee #1 walked from the driver's side of the truck to the passenger's side to check that the vehicle would clear the safety lights. He then returned to the driver's side and continued to direct the driver before crossing back over to the passenger's side. At this point, the coworker lost sight of Employee #1. He continued to back the truck slowly and checked both mirrors constantly, but did not spot him until he saw Employee #1 lying, face down, in front of the truck. He had been run over and killed. Employee #1 was wearing a light blue coverall with a reflective traffic vest; his goggles were found approximately 15 ft away from his body. The post mortem exam found the cause of death to be multiple blunt force injuries, and the event was determined to have been an accident.
